Published in 1960, "The Child Buyer" is a dystopian novel that imagines a world in which corporations can purchase and exploit the talents of gifted children. The story follows a mysterious man named Mr. Wissey, who travels the country seeking out exceptional youngsters and offering to buy them from their families. As he encounters resistance and skepticism, Wissey's true motives come into question, and the novel builds to a harrowing and thought-provoking climax.
